正则表达式字符串的第一个字符必须为大写,其他则为小写

时间:2018-09-09 19:51:04

标签: java regex

我需要编写一种用于验证用户名的方法,这是一些限制:

  1. 首字母必须大写
  2. 其他字母必须小写
  3. 名称只能包含1个单词
  4. 不允许使用其他符号或空格

因此,我需要一个正则表达式来与正则表达式匹配字符串。请帮帮我。

我现在才写这个:

boolean matches= updatedName.matches( "(?<=\b[A-Z]+)[a-z]");

0 个答案:

没有答案